
The Confederation of African Football (CAF) has thrown out Nigeria’s appeal against Guinea, fielding an ineligible player in the 2023 Africa U-23 Cup of Nations qualifier in March.
Guinea progressed into the 2023 U-23 AFCON finals after a 2-0 aggregate victory against the Olympic Eagles.
The first leg ended in a barren draw, with the Guineans winning the reverse fixture 2-0.
The NFF protested that one of the players fielded by Guinea in the game; Alseny Soumah was not within the age limit.
The Guinea Football Federation established it was a case of mistaken identity as there were two different players with the name, Alsény Soumah.
The Guineans will take on host Morocco in the opening game of the U-23 AFCON.
Cameroon were however lucky as they won their protest against Gabon.
They will now replace the Gabonese in Group B of the competition.
